Полное руководство по TOGAF ADM: Основа архитектурного фреймворка The Open Group

Введение в TOGAF ADM

Архитектурный фреймворк The Open Group (TOGAF) — это широко признанный фреймворк корпоративной архитектуры, который предлагает всесторонний подход к проектированию, планированию, внедрению и управлению ИТ-архитектурой предприятия. В центре TOGAF лежит методология разработки архитектуры (ADM), циклический процесс, который направляет разработку корпоративной архитектуры.

ADM разработан для удовлетворения бизнес-процессов и потребностей ИТ любой организации, обеспечивая соответствие корпоративной архитектуры стратегическим целям организации. В этом руководстве будет представлен подробный обзор этапов, входящих в цикл ADM, а также практические примеры, иллюстрирующие каждый этап.

Этапы TOGAF ADM

1. Предварительный этап

Цель:Установить основу и принципы для плана разработки архитектуры.

Деятельность:

  • Определить принципы архитектуры, которые будут направлять процесс разработки.
  • Создать архитектурный фреймворк, включая модель управления и план управления заинтересованными сторонами.
  • Определить архитектурное хранилище, где будут храниться все архитектурные артефакты.

Пример:Розничная компания решает внедрить TOGAF ADM для согласования своей ИТ-инфраструктуры с бизнес-целями. На предварительном этапе компания определяет свои принципы архитектуры, например, «максимально использовать существующие ИТ-активы» и «обеспечить масштабируемость для поддержки роста бизнеса». Компания также создает архитектурное хранилище с помощью совместного инструмента, такого как Confluence, для хранения всех архитектурных документов.

2. Видение архитектуры

Цель:Четко определить общую стратегию в качестве архитектора ИТ.

Деятельность:

  • Разработать видение архитектуры, включающее охват, заинтересованные стороны, вопросы и бизнес-цели.
  • Создать заявление о работе по архитектуре, в котором описаны цели и ожидаемые результаты.
  • Получите одобрение заинтересованных сторон на архитектурную концепцию.

Пример: IT-архитектор розничной компании разрабатывает концепцию архитектуры, направленную на улучшение пользовательского опыта за счет интеграции онлайн- и офлайн-покупок. Концепция включает заинтересованные стороны, такие как отдел маркетинга, IT-команда и представители службы поддержки клиентов. Заявление о работе по архитектуре определяет цели бесшовного взаимодействия с клиентами и увеличения продаж за счет интеграции многоканальных каналов.

3. Бизнес-архитектура

Цель: Опишите текущую бизнес-архитектуру и определите цели.

Деятельность:

  • Документируйте текущие бизнес-процессы, организационную структуру и бизнес-возможности.
  • Определите разрывы между текущим состоянием и желаемым будущим состоянием.
  • Определите целевую бизнес-архитектуру, которая устраняет эти разрывы.

Пример: IT-архитектор документирует текущие бизнес-процессы, такие как обработка заказов, управление запасами и поддержка клиентов. Они выявляют разрывы, такие как отсутствие обновления данных о запасах в реальном времени и неэффективная обработка заказов. Целевая бизнес-архитектура включает отслеживание запасов в реальном времени и автоматизированную обработку заказов для повышения эффективности и удовлетворенности клиентов.

4. Архитектура информационных систем

Цель:Разработайте архитектуры информационных систем.

Деятельность:

  • Определите архитектуру данных, включая модели данных, принципы управления данными и управление данными.
  • Разработайте архитектуру приложений, включая компоненты приложений, взаимодействие и стратегии интеграции.
  • Разработайте технологическую архитектуру, включая аппаратное обеспечение, программное обеспечение и сетевую инфраструктуру.

Пример: Архитектор ИТ проектирует архитектуру данных, включающую централизованное хранилище данных для обновления инвентаря в реальном времени. Архитектура приложений включает микросервисы для обработки заказов и поддержки клиентов. Архитектура технологий определяет использование облачной инфраструктуры для масштабируемости и надежности.

5. Архитектура технологий

Цель: Создать общую целевую архитектуру и интегрировать будущие разработки.

Деятельность:

  • Разработать целевую архитектуру технологий, которая поддерживает архитектуры бизнеса и информационных систем.
  • Интегрировать будущие тенденции и инновации в области технологий в целевую архитектуру.
  • Обеспечить соответствие архитектуры технологий бизнес-целям и стратегии ИТ.

Пример: Архитектор ИТ создает целевую архитектуру технологий, включающую использование искусственного интеллекта и машинного обучения для прогнозной аналитики. Архитектура также включает будущие разработки, такие как Интернет вещей (IoT) для отслеживания инвентаря в реальном времени. Архитектура технологий разработана с целью поддержки бизнес-целей по улучшению пользовательского опыта и увеличению продаж.

6. Возможности и решения

Цель:Завершить общую целевую архитектуру.

Деятельность:

  • Выявить возможности для улучшения и инноваций в рамках целевой архитектуры.
  • Разработать блоки решений, которые решают эти возможности.
  • Обеспечить всесторонний характер целевой архитектуры и ее соответствие всем бизнес- и ИТ-требованиям.

Пример: Архитектор ИТ выявляет возможности для улучшения, например, улучшение пользовательского интерфейса приложений, ориентированных на клиентов. Они разрабатывают блоки решений, такие как фреймворк адаптивного дизайна и руководящие принципы пользовательского опыта (UX). Целевая архитектура проверяется и завершается для обеспечения соответствия всем бизнес- и ИТ-требованиям.

7. Планирование миграции

Цель: Разработать план миграции с текущей архитектуры на целевую архитектуру.

Деятельность:

  • Разработать план миграции, в котором описаны шаги, сроки и ресурсы, необходимые для перехода.
  • Приоритизировать проекты на основе бизнес-ценности, рисков и зависимостей.
  • Обеспечить соответствие плана миграции общей стратегии ИТ и бизнес-целям.

Пример: Архитектор ИТ разрабатывает план миграции, включающий поэтапную реализацию новой архитектуры. План приоритизирует проекты на основе бизнес-ценности, например, отслеживание запасов в реальном времени и автоматизированная обработка заказов. План миграции соответствует стратегии ИТ и бизнес-целям по улучшению пользовательского опыта и увеличению продаж.

8. Государственное управление реализацией

Цель:Управлять реализацией целевой архитектуры.

Деятельность:

  • Установить процессы управления для мониторинга и контроля реализации целевой архитектуры.
  • Обеспечить соответствие принципам архитектуры, стандартам и лучшим практикам.
  • Управлять рисками и проблемами, возникающими в процессе реализации.

Пример: Архитектор ИТ создает совет управления, в который входят представители команды ИТ, бизнес-подразделений и внешних консультантов. Совет регулярно собирается для обзора хода реализации, обеспечения соответствия принципам архитектуры и решения любых возникающих рисков или проблем.

9. Управление изменениями архитектуры

Цель:Мониторить работающую систему и определять, когда необходимо начать новый цикл.

Деятельность:

  • Контролировать производительность и эффективность реализованной архитектуры.
  • Выявлять изменения в бизнес-среде или информационной среде, которые могут потребовать нового цикла ADM.
  • Инициировать новый цикл ADM при необходимости, вернувшись к предварительной фазе.

Пример: Архитектор ИТ отслеживает производительность новой архитектуры и выявляет области для улучшения. Он также следит за тенденциями отрасли и технологическими достижениями. Если происходят значительные изменения, например, новые бизнес-цели или появляющиеся технологии, архитектор ИТ инициирует новый цикл ADM, чтобы обеспечить соответствие архитектуры потребностям бизнеса.

Заключение

TOGAF ADM предоставляет структурированный и всесторонний подход к разработке корпоративной архитектуры, соответствующей целям бизнеса и потребностям ИТ. Следуя четко определенным фазам ADM, специалисты ИТ могут обеспечить систематичность, прозрачность и соответствие процесса разработки архитектуры стратегическим целям организации. Понимание и внедрение TOGAF ADM является обязательным для любого специалиста ИТ, специализирующегося на корпоративной архитектуре.

Ссылки

Список ссылок на инструмент TOGAF от Visual Paradigm

  1. Мощный набор инструментов TOGAF ADM

    • URLИнструменты TOGAF ADM от Visual Paradigm
    • Описание: Комплексный набор инструментов TOGAF, обеспечивающий пошаговый подход к разработке результатов, необходимых в методологии разработки архитектуры TOGAF (ADM). Включает простые в понимании инструкции, передовые инструменты моделирования, реальные примеры и руководства экспертов.
  2. Лучшее программное обеспечение TOGAF

    • URLЛучшее программное обеспечение TOGAF
    • Описание: Обсуждаются преимущества использования Visual Paradigm для TOGAF, включая поддержку ArchiMate 3, и то, как он помогает в понимании и реализации методологии TOGAF ADM.
  3. Лучшее программное обеспечение TOGAF с Agile и UML – Visual Paradigm Enterprise

    • URLVisual Paradigm Enterprise
    • Описание: Подчеркивается, что Visual Paradigm Enterprise — это инструмент корпоративного архитектурного проектирования ArchiMate, сертифицированный The Open Group. Он поддерживает различные лексико-семантические, нотационные, синтаксические и семантические элементы для всех элементов и отношений языка ArchiMate.
  4. Освоение корпоративной архитектуры с помощью инструмента TOGAF от Visual Paradigm

  5. Инструмент TOGAF® для корпоративной архитектуры

  6. Visual Paradigm TOGAF – Все о TOGAF, корпоративной архитектуре, ArchiMate и многом другом

    • URLVisual Paradigm TOGAF
    • Описание: Предоставляет подробное руководство по ArchiMate 3 и его интеграции с TOGAF ADM, предоставляя архитекторам мощный инструмент для выражения сложных моделей.
  7. Visual Paradigm: Современная многофункциональная платформа визуального моделирования для корпоративной архитектуры и проектирования программного обеспечения

    • URLArchiMetric – Обзор Visual Paradigm
    • Описание: Обсуждает, как Visual Paradigm поддерживает TOGAF, ADM, ArchiMate, BPMN и UML, делая его идеальным выбором для архитекторов корпоративной архитектуры, бизнес-аналитиков и разработчиков программного обеспечения.
  8. Практическое руководство по TOGAF

    • URLVisual Paradigm – Практическое руководство по TOGAF
    • Описание: Бесплатное руководство по TOGAF, которое помогает пользователям понять ADM, архитектурную структуру содержания, корпоративный континуум, справочную модель и архитектурную структуру компетенций.
  9. Пошаговое руководство по корпоративной архитектуре с использованием TOGAF

Эти ссылки предоставляют всесторонний обзор инструментов TOGAF Visual Paradigm и их применения при разработке архитектуры предприятия.